This study group will
aim to study the mathematical problems related to
biological network/pathway analysis, which is one of the most
challenging
problem in the era of functional genomics. Reviews regarding this
research
area are collected in
http://ihome.cuhk.edu.hk/~b400559/arraysoft_pathway.html.
The possible approaches
will include Boolean networks, Bayesian networks, differential
equations, and so forth. Researchers from a variety of disciplines will
get together to stimulate research topics from different perspectives in
mathematics, computation, and biology. The meeting time will be every
Thursday afternoon that starts from March 3, 1:30pm. The first four
weeks will review and discuss the
research topics in
Boolean networks.
